Skip to content
905-901-0360
Contact Us
About
Why Us
Industries
Vendor Partners
Solutions
Apply Now
905-901-0360
Contact Us
Main Menu
905-901-0360
Contact Us
About
Why Us
Industries
Vendor Partners
Solutions
Apply Now
905-901-0360
Contact Us
Main Menu
Thank You
Thank you for subscribing to our newsletter.
About
Why Us
Industries
Vendor Partners
Solutions
Apply Now
About
Why Us
Industries
Vendor Partners
Solutions
Apply Now